Project manager, consultant and lecturer, since 12 years working on issues of Diversity, human resources development and organisational development. She worked for 10 years at the University of Mainz, including 4 years in South Africa involved in research, teaching and consultancy - funded by the Volkswagen-Foundation.
She teaches Diversity Management in Business Administration and has a special focus on health care. Since March 2008 she is project manager for a programme on behalf of the German Federal Government on quality criteria and standards in training and cultural diversity in human resources development and organisational development for the profit and non-profit sector in cooperation with organisations who signed the "Charta der Vielfalt".
Published various books, articles and conference publications on Diversity, culture, management issues, health care, globalisation and international development.
Academic education in Mainz (Germany), Johannesburg (South Africa) and Nijmegen (The Netherlands).
Continuous education in project management, moderation and as EFQM-assessor.
